[Zope-CVS] CVS: Packages/zpkgtools/zpkgtools - dependencies.py:1.4

Fred L. Drake, Jr. fred at zope.com
Wed Apr 7 23:50:47 EDT 2004


Update of /cvs-repository/Packages/zpkgtools/zpkgtools
In directory cvs.zope.org:/tmp/cvs-serv10049

Modified Files:
	dependencies.py 
Log Message:
minor nit: just skip blank lines in dependency data; this is not PEP 262


=== Packages/zpkgtools/zpkgtools/dependencies.py 1.3 => 1.4 ===
--- Packages/zpkgtools/zpkgtools/dependencies.py:1.3	Mon Mar 29 11:50:58 2004
+++ Packages/zpkgtools/zpkgtools/dependencies.py	Wed Apr  7 23:50:15 2004
@@ -20,11 +20,9 @@
 
 def load(f):
     deps = sets.Set()
-    while True:
-        line = f.readline().strip()
-        if not line:
-            return deps
-        if line[0] == "#":
+    for line in f:
+        line = line.strip()
+        if line[:1] in ("", "#"):
             continue
         dep = locationmap.normalizeResourceId(line)
         deps.add(dep)




More information about the Zope-CVS mailing list